- Tomcat 설치
- Tomcat 환경변수 설정
- CATALINA_HOME
- CLASSPATH
Tomcat 설치
아파치 사이트(http://tomcat.apache.org/) 접속하여 맨 하단 Tomcat 클릭
해당하는 파일 다운로드 후 zip파일 압축을 풉니다.
해당 경로(conf 폴더) 이동하여 server.xml을 열어보면 다음과 같이 포트번호가 8080으로 돼있는 것을 확인할 수 있습니다. 그런데 포트번호 8080은 오라클에서 사용하기 때문에 충돌 가능성 때문에, 아래와 같이 80(http포트)으로 바꿔줍니다.
이제는 톰캣이 정상적으로 작동하는 지 확인해보려고 하는데 그 방법은 아래와 같습니다.
해당경로(bin폴더)에서 startup.bat이라는 배치파일(MS-DOS, OS/2, 윈도우에서 쓰이는 배치 파일(batch file)은 명령 인터프리터에 의해 실행되게끔 고안된 명령어들이 나열되어 있는 텍스트 파일입니다.) 더블클릭 하면,
위와 같이 배치파일이 실행되는데 실행창에서 오류나 심각 메시지가 나오지 않는지 확인합니다.
이렇게 톰캣 서버 실행 후, 브라우저 주소창에 localhost를 입력하여 톰캣 고양이 화면이 나오면 성공!(서버가 제대로 돌고 있다는 것)
톰캣 종료는 shutdown.bat 배치파일 더블클릭
Tomcat 환경변수 설정
CATALINA_HOME
변수 이름 : CATALINA_HOME
변수 값 : 톰캣 설치 경로
jdk 설치한 후 jdk 환경변수 설정했다면, 이미 CLASSPATH가 환경변수로 잡혀 있을텐데 그러면 수정 눌러서 다음과 같이 수정 혹은 추가 해줍니다.
변수 이름 : CLASSPATH
변수 값 : %JAVA_HOME%\jre\lib\rt.jar;%CATALINA_HOME%\lib\servlet-api.jar
복사해서 붙여 넣으면 \이 아니라 위처럼 나옵니다.
- rt.jar는 lang패키지 클래스, rmi 클래스, 컬렉션 클래스 등 모두 갖고 있는 클래스 압축파일
- servlet-api.jar는 어플리케이션 서버(확장된 CGI)를 실행하기 위한 서블릿 클래스 등을 갖고 있는 클래스 압축파일
Comments: